Deere Announces More Than 160 Layoffs At Quad Cities Plants

MOLINE, Illinois - Deere and Company announced that over 150 positions would be cut at two Quad Cities locations. Company officials announced this is an "indefinite layoff" but few details were given.

The company states that due to decreased customer demand, they plan to lay off 50 production workers at the John Deer Harvester Works on October 28th. Another 113 production employees at the John Deer Davenport Works would be placed on indefinite layoff starting November 18th.

The company states the layoffs are also necessary due to lower income expectations. Deere balances the size of production workforce with customer demand for products at individual factories.

Layoffs will apparently only impact these two locations as no others were mentioned by company officials.
